How many lakes are in California?

3,000
The US state of California is a geographically diverse region with the Mojave Desert, the Sierra Nevada, and the Central Valley making up the state’s main terrain. California is home to about 3,000 named lakes, dry lakes, and reservoirs. Some of the lakes drain into the ocean while others are completely landlocked.

What’s the deepest lake in California?

Lake Tahoe
In terms of volume, the largest lake on the list is Lake Tahoe, located on the California–Nevada border. It holds roughly 36 cubic miles (150 km3) of water. It is also the largest freshwater lake by area, at 191 sq mi (490 km2), and the deepest lake, with a maximum depth of 1,645 feet (501 m).

Does California have any natural lakes?

Clear Lake is the largest natural freshwater lake located entirely within California, with 100 miles of shoreline and a surface area of 67 square miles. The adjacent Clear Lake State Park offers hiking trails, a visitor center, campgrounds and cabin rentals.

What is the largest man made lake in California?

Shasta Reservoir
Shasta Reservoir is California’s largest man-made lake with a gross pool storage capacity of 4,552,000 acre-feet. Shasta Dam and Reservoir are located on the upper Sacramento River in northern California about 9 miles northwest of the City of Redding. The entire reservoir is within Shasta County.

What lake in California is drying up?

Lake Oroville
California’s Drought Drying Up Lake Oroville, Shutting Down Power Plant At Wildfire Season Peak. SACRAMENTO (CBS13) – California’s drought is drying up the second-largest reservoir in the state: Lake Oroville. When it’s full, the lake sits around 900 feet. But water levels have been dropping fast in recent weeks.
